Transaction 0cd7cd2d0f03ab9495a8109560136c4e0b97192028f187ef2616ee974d455148

3 Input
1 Outputs
  • 0cd7cd2d0f03ab9495a8109560136c4e0b97192028f187ef2616ee974d455148:0
  • value  60383374
    address  3FDtscdYDoNmjRm1ijYLeBj1hoW6QhtL9J